数据库用什么软件编程好
-
在选择数据库编程软件时,需要考虑多个因素,包括软件的功能、易用性、性能、安全性以及支持的数据库类型等。下面列举了几个常用的数据库编程软件,供您参考选择:
-
MySQL Workbench:MySQL Workbench是MySQL官方推出的一款强大的数据库管理工具。它提供了丰富的功能,包括数据库设计、SQL开发、数据模型编辑、数据导入导出等。MySQL Workbench支持多种操作系统,并且与MySQL数据库的集成非常紧密。
-
Microsoft SQL Server Management Studio:Microsoft SQL Server Management Studio是微软官方提供的用于管理和开发SQL Server的工具。它具有直观的用户界面,支持广泛的功能,包括数据库设计、查询编写、性能优化、安全管理等。此外,SQL Server Management Studio还支持与其他Microsoft产品的集成,如Visual Studio等。
-
Oracle SQL Developer:Oracle SQL Developer是Oracle公司提供的一款免费的数据库开发工具。它支持Oracle数据库的管理和开发,具有强大的功能,包括SQL编辑器、数据模型设计、数据导入导出、PL/SQL开发等。此外,Oracle SQL Developer还支持与其他Oracle产品的集成,如Oracle Application Express等。
-
PostgreSQL:PostgreSQL是一款开源的关系型数据库管理系统,它具有高度的可扩展性和可定制性。PostgreSQL提供了丰富的功能,包括复杂查询、事务处理、并发控制等。它的编程接口非常丰富,支持多种编程语言,如Python、Java、C++等。
-
MongoDB Compass:MongoDB Compass是MongoDB官方提供的图形化界面工具,用于管理和查询MongoDB数据库。它提供了直观的用户界面,支持可视化地创建、编辑和查询MongoDB的文档。此外,MongoDB Compass还提供了性能分析、数据导入导出等功能。
综上所述,选择数据库编程软件时,需要根据自身的需求和技术栈来选择合适的工具。以上列举的软件都是常用且功能强大的数据库编程工具,您可以根据自己的情况进行选择。
1年前 -
-
选择数据库编程软件时,可以根据以下几个因素进行考虑:
-
数据库类型:首先需要确定要使用的数据库类型,例如关系型数据库(如MySQL、Oracle、SQL Server)或非关系型数据库(如MongoDB、Redis)。不同类型的数据库往往有不同的编程要求和特点。
-
编程语言:根据自己的编程经验和技能,选择与数据库兼容的编程语言。常用的数据库编程语言包括SQL、Java、Python、C#等。某些数据库还提供了专门的编程接口和SDK,可以更方便地进行数据库编程。
-
功能和性能要求:根据项目需求,评估数据库编程软件提供的功能和性能。例如,某些软件可能提供了强大的查询和分析功能,而另一些软件可能更适合处理大规模的数据和高并发访问。
-
开发和维护成本:考虑数据库编程软件的开发和维护成本。有些软件可能需要购买许可证或支付订阅费用,而其他软件可能是开源的或免费的。同时,还要考虑软件的社区支持和更新频率,以确保能够及时解决问题和获取新功能。
-
生态系统和扩展性:了解数据库编程软件的生态系统和可扩展性。一些软件拥有庞大的用户群体和丰富的第三方库和插件,可以更轻松地扩展和定制。此外,还要考虑软件的稳定性和可靠性,以确保数据的安全和一致性。
综上所述,选择数据库编程软件需要综合考虑数据库类型、编程语言、功能和性能要求、开发和维护成本,以及生态系统和扩展性。根据具体项目需求和个人技术背景,选择适合的软件进行数据库编程。
1年前 -
-
当涉及到数据库编程时,有多种软件可以选择。以下是一些常用的数据库编程软件:
-
MySQL:MySQL是一种开源的关系型数据库管理系统(RDBMS),它被广泛用于Web应用程序的后端开发。MySQL提供了用于操作和管理数据库的SQL语言,同时支持多种编程语言,如PHP、Python和Java等。MySQL还具有强大的性能和可扩展性。
-
Oracle:Oracle是一种功能强大的关系型数据库管理系统,广泛用于企业级应用程序的开发。Oracle具有高度可靠性、安全性和可伸缩性,适用于处理大型数据和复杂业务逻辑的应用。
-
Microsoft SQL Server:Microsoft SQL Server是一种关系型数据库管理系统,由Microsoft开发。它适用于Microsoft Windows操作系统,提供了一套强大的工具和功能,用于开发和管理数据库。SQL Server支持多种编程语言,如C#、VB.NET和Java等。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,具有高度可扩展性和稳定性。它支持SQL语言和多种编程语言,如C、C++、Python和Java等。PostgreSQL还提供了许多高级功能,如事务处理、并发控制和复制等。
-
MongoDB:MongoDB是一种开源的文档数据库,它使用类似于JSON的BSON格式存储数据。MongoDB适用于处理大量非结构化数据和需要动态模式的应用程序。它支持多种编程语言,如JavaScript、Python和Java等。
选择合适的数据库编程软件取决于项目需求、技术要求和开发团队的熟悉程度。开发人员应根据项目的具体需求和技术背景来选择最合适的数据库软件。
1年前 -